The 1st round was the screening call, asking for basic technical questions along with general questions.
The 2nd round was the full technical round, based on Java, Spring Boot, microservices, and SQL.
The 3rd round was with the technical panel on a video call, starting with Java and Linux commands.
What are methods in the Files class?
What are the functions in the Map interface?
What are the functions in the InputStream class?
What is the ps command in Linux?
What are the synchronized classes?
